Decoding the Viral Phenomenon: What Does Glass Skin Actually Mean in 2026?
The term glass skin, or yuri pibu in Korean, didn't just fall from the sky into our Sephora carts. It represents an aesthetic ideal where the face appears so smooth, clear, and intensely hydrated that it takes on the reflective, translucent quality of a pane of glass. But where it gets tricky is the shift from a skincare goal to a social currency. It isn't just about being "clear." It’s about a specific level of interstitial fluid saturation and epidermal refinement that makes the skin look almost wet to the touch. Because the human eye associates light reflection with youth, this look has become the shorthand for "I have my life together."
The Seoul Connection and the Rise of Yuri Pibu
We have to look back at the early 2010s in Seoul, specifically the influence of K-Beauty influencers and makeup artists like Ellie Choi, who catapulted the 7-skin method into the global zeitgeist. This wasn't a flash in the pan. The philosophy was centered on deep aqueous layering rather than the Western obsession with harsh exfoliation or "stripping" the moisture barrier. But here is the nuance: in its original context, glass skin was a testament to patience. It was a lifestyle choice. Yet, as it crossed oceans, the nuance was lost, and it became a "look" to be bought through a specific set of serums. Honestly, it’s unclear if the global market ever truly understood the meditative aspect of the routine or just wanted the shiny finish.

Texture vs. Tone: The Great Dermatological Divide
Most people don't think about this enough, but light reflection—the "glass" part—is a physics problem as much as a biological one. Smooth surfaces reflect light in a specular fashion, while uneven surfaces scatter it. This is why dermaplaning and chemical peels are often the "shortcuts" to the glow, but they carry risks of transepidermal water loss (TEWL). Mirror, Mirror: Comparing Glass Skin to the "Cloud Skin" Alternative
Except that not everyone wants to look like a glazed donut. Enter "Cloud Skin," the antithesis to the glass skin movement that emerged as a more inclusive, soft-focus alternative. While glass skin prioritizes high-shine and transparency, cloud skin leans into a demi-matte finish that mimics the way light filters through a cloud—dreamy, diffused, and significantly more forgiving of post-inflammatory hyperpigmentation (PIH). This shift suggests that the "glass" compliment might be losing its luster as people crave a look that doesn't require a constant supply of blotting papers or a 500-watt ring light to maintain. Which is better? Experts disagree, and honestly, the answer is usually "whichever one doesn't make you feel like you're failing a test."

The Mirage of Perfection: Common Misconceptions
The Hydration Fallacy
Many believe achieving translucent luminosity is merely a matter of drinking three liters of water daily. It is not. While systemic hydration supports cellular turnover, the visual effect of glass skin relies almost exclusively on topical humectants and lipids. The problem is that the skin barrier functions as a gatekeeper, not a sponge. You can drown your internal organs in distilled water, yet your epidermis may remain as parched as a desert floor if your ambient humidity is below 30%. High molecular weight hyaluronic acid often sits on the surface, pulling moisture out of your face rather than into it if the air is dry. This irony defines the industry. Scientists at the Journal of Cosmetic Dermatology note that transepidermal water loss (TEWL) can increase by 20% in air-conditioned environments, rendering your internal hydration moot. You need occlusives, not just a bigger water bottle.

Frequently Asked Questions
Does the glass skin trend work for all skin types?
Technically, any skin type can improve its light-reflectivity, but the visual manifestation differs wildly between oily and dry profiles. Research indicates that approximately 70% of individuals with Fitzpatrick Scale types IV through VI may experience post-inflammatory hyperpigmentation if they use the aggressive exfoliation often recommended for this look. For those with oily skin, the heavy layering of essences can lead to malassezia folliculitis, an overgrowth of yeast that creates tiny bumps. Dry skin types find the trend more accessible, as their barrier naturally lacks the lipids that the glass skin routine provides in abundance. The problem is that a "one size fits all" approach usually results in a clogged pore disaster for at least half the population.

How long does it take to see actual results from a glass skin routine?
Real biological change follows the desquamation cycle, which takes roughly 28 to 40 days depending on your age. While you can achieve an immediate temporary glow using high-glycerin products or light-reflecting primers, structural improvement requires patience. Data shows that collagen synthesis and significant pigment correction usually require 12 weeks of consistent application of actives like retinoids or Vitamin C. Most consumers quit their routines after 14 days because the "glass" doesn't appear instantly, leading to a cycle of product hopping that destroys the skin's pH balance. In short, the reflection you see in the first week is mostly optical illusion, while the reflection in the third month is the result of genuine cellular repair.
